GCF Calculator First Number and Second Number and Calculate GCF WebThe Greatest Common Factor (GCF) for 90 and 135, notation CGF (90,135), is 45. Explanation: The factors of 90 are 1,2,3,5,6,9,10,15,18,30,45,90; The factors of 135 are 1,3,5,9,15,27,45,135. So, as we can see, the Greatest Common Factor or Divisor is 45, because it is the greatest number that divides evenly into all of them. Quote of the day... WebThe Greatest Common Factor (GCF) for 90 and 27, notation CGF (90,27), is 9. Explanation: The factors of 90 are 1,2,3,5,6,9,10,15,18,30,45,90; The factors of 27 are 1,3,9,27.
